The phrase "acquiring unit" is correct and usable in written English.
It can be used in contexts related to business, finance, or organizational structures, typically referring to a department or team responsible for acquiring assets or resources.
Example: "The acquiring unit has been tasked with identifying potential merger opportunities to expand our market presence."
Alternatives: "purchasing department" or "acquisition team".
